Median Home Price in Keene, TX

The median home value in Keene, TX is $255,562 as of 2026-06-30, down 3.27% from a year earlier.

Keene ranks #197 of 346 Texas c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 6.0% below the state's city median of $271,742. It sits in Johnson County, where the county-wide median is $344,399.

Crime in Keene

Keene police recorded a violent crime rate of 143 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— around the middle of the range for reporting cities. Property crime runs at 499 per 100,000.

Reported by the city's own police department to the FBI's Uniform Crime Reporting Program (what this covers).
